Tamil Nadu Minister Vanni Arasu Rebuts Premalatha Vijayakant on VCK‑TVK Alliance

Minister Vanni Arasu publicly challenged Premalatha Vijayakant's comments concerning the VCK‑TVK alliance, asserting that the remarks misrepresent the coalition's objectives.
Tamil Nadu's minister Vanni Arasu took to the media to dispute statements made by Premalatha Vijayakant regarding the alliance between the Viduthalai Chiruthaigal Katchi (VCK) and the Tamil Nadu Vanniyur Katchi (TVK). Arasu argued that Vijayakant's remarks oversimplify the political partnership and could mislead the public about its policy agenda.
In his response, the minister emphasized that the VCK‑TVK alliance is rooted in shared regional concerns and aims to address specific community issues within the state. He urged political commentators to base their analysis on factual developments rather than conjecture.
Arasu's counterstatement comes amid heightened scrutiny of coalition dynamics ahead of upcoming local elections, where both parties are expected to contest key constituencies together. The minister called for constructive dialogue among parties to strengthen democratic discourse.
The exchange highlights the sensitivity surrounding alliance politics in Tamil Nadu, where party leaders frequently engage in public debates to clarify their positions.
No further comments were recorded from Premalatha Vijayakant at the time of reporting.
